Half of work related illness is down to stress, depression or anxiety

Workplace Insight

Nearly two million workers in Great Britain reported suffering from work-related ill health in 2022/23, according the latest annual statistical report from the UK’s Health and Safety Executive. Firms growing concerned about increase in litigation

Workplace Insight

Since 2019, more than two in five (43 percent) UK business say they have been subjected to legal threats, with many facing multiple occurrences; more than a quarter (28 percent) said they had seen cases of litigation increase by more than 40 percent over the past five years.
